Many electric customers in central Arkansas without power are still trying to get their hands on generators, and in most cases, there haven't been any to be found.
Saturday morning, a spokesperson from Home Depot at 12,610 Chenal Parkway called to say the store is receiving a shipment of 85 new generators at 10 a.m. More than a dozen people are already on a waiting list to buy the first generators in that shipment, but for the others, it will be first come first served.
